How to Disable Snap Link Previews

You’ve seen them — the annoying little bits of bling, as Nick Wilson aptly characterized them — that pop up a little thumbnail of the page a link points to. How can you get rid of these bothersome gnats that flutter up all over blog and web pages these days? Well, you could go to the snap site and download a cookie, but if you don’t want to do that, follow these simple steps:

1. Use Firefox as your browser and download and install the adblock extension.

2. Go to adblock preferences (under the tools menu) and add as a new filter: spa.snap.com/snap_preview_anywhere.js.
